Quote:
Originally Posted by not_so_new
Thanks Thrill.... so about how much does Reaktor 5 street for and are the ensembles free to trade (I would assume so but.. you know...).
Reaktor 5 goes for about $400. You can also buy ensembles for it very cheaply.

As has been mentioned, Reaktor is a hardware hog and depending on your configuration, may give you problems.

But it is in many ways the Rolls Royce of synthesizers. And you can build your own "synths" known as the ensembles.

Be aware that there are many, many software synthesizers out there. EastWest also do dedicated sample playback instruments that, depending on your style, can provide great sounds.

Also look at ilio's Atmosphere, Arturia's emulation of Moog synths and just keep looking. There's a ton out there.
